Kenilworth charity shop launches appeal for more volunteers

By James Smith   17th Nov 2023

Could you volunteer at Acorns on Warwick Road? (images supplied)
Could you volunteer at Acorns on Warwick Road? (images supplied)

A Kenilworth charity shop is on the hunt for more volunteers to help out at its town centre store.

Acorns on Warwick Road is looking for locals who can spare a few hours a week to help the charity raise money for the work it does supporting young people and families.

Acorns Children's Hospice provides specialist palliative care for life limited and life threatened babies, children and young people and support for their families.

The charity operates three hospices - in Worcester, Birmingham and Walsall - as well as providing care in family homes and in the community.

"Could you volunteer in your local Acorns Charity Shop, Warwick Road?" a charity spokesperson said.

"At Acorns, our dedicated teams provide specialist palliative care for life limited and life threatened children and support for their families.

"Our award winning charity shops provide essential funds to support this care and we couldn't operate without the help of our valued volunteers who give us their time: from a few hours a week to a couple of days."
